I have multiple web servers, each has one carbon installed with the following config: - carbon.conf [aggregator] LINE_RECEIVER_INTERFACE = 0.0.0.0 LINE_RECEIVER_PORT = 8090 PICKLE_RECEIVER_INTERFACE = 0.0.0.0 PICKLE_RECEIVER_PORT = 8092 DESTINATIONS = graph.local:2014 REPLICATION_FACTOR = 1 MAX_QUEUE_SIZE = 20000 USE_FLOW_CONTROL = True MAX_DATAPOINTS_PER_MESSAGE = 1000 MAX_AGGREGATION_INTERVALS = 20 LOG_LISTENER_CONN_SUCCESS = False - aggregation-rules.conf live.<server>.metric.<metric> (60) = sum live.<server>.metric.<metric> Web server are sending metrics in plain text to localhost:8090 for example "live.web1.metric.search 1408564809 1" I have one server graph.local:2014 receiving all aggregated metrics with a carbon installed as followed: - carbon.conf [cache] USER = MAX_CACHE_SIZE = inf MAX_UPDATES_PER_SECOND = 500 MAX_CREATES_PER_MINUTE = 50 LINE_RECEIVER_INTERFACE = 0.0.0.0 LINE_RECEIVER_PORT = 2003 ENABLE_UDP_LISTENER = False UDP_RECEIVER_INTERFACE = 0.0.0.0 UDP_RECEIVER_PORT = 2003 PICKLE_RECEIVER_INTERFACE = 0.0.0.0 PICKLE_RECEIVER_PORT = 2004 USE_INSECURE_UNPICKLER = False CACHE_QUERY_INTERFACE = 0.0.0.0 CACHE_QUERY_PORT = 7002 USE_FLOW_CONTROL = True LOG_UPDATES = True WHISPER_AUTOFLUSH = False [aggregator] LINE_RECEIVER_INTERFACE = 0.0.0.0 LINE_RECEIVER_PORT = 2013 PICKLE_RECEIVER_INTERFACE = 0.0.0.0 PICKLE_RECEIVER_PORT = 2014 DESTINATIONS = 127.0.0.1:2004 REPLICATION_FACTOR = 1 MAX_QUEUE_SIZE = 10000 USE_FLOW_CONTROL = True MAX_DATAPOINTS_PER_MESSAGE = 500 MAX_AGGREGATION_INTERVALS = 5 - aggregation-rules.conf live.all.metric.<metric> (60) = sum live.web*.metric.<metric> On graphite I see both live.all.metric.search and live.web*.metric.search. live.web*.metric.search values are correct. live.all.metric.search values are about a third higher than live.web*.metric.search In carbong log it says live.web1.metric.search could not match aggregator rule. 1) Why do I see live.web*.metric.search ? Isn't suppose to not being sent to graphite because of the second aggregator? 2) Why live.all.metric.search value are a third more than live.web*.metric.search? 3) I use line receiver port on the first aggregator since my data are plain text, then this aggregator destination is the second aggregator (graph.local) pickle port. Is that correct ?
